Sheared my hub bolts/studs
hey guys i got a 1991 pickup with an 84 front axle and i was trying to pull buddy out of a stuck and heard a snap and found that i had sheered all my bollts on the driver side hub and i was wondering if anybody had any ideas how to get the broken halves out. much appreciated thx
#3
Sheared all the manual hub studs?
Disassemble, remove the wheel hub, and then drill and tap.
Might be able to get them to come out with left hand drill bits or easy outs.
Or drill out as much as you can and try to pick out the pieces then drill and tap.
If you don't think you can get them out, buy a new wheel hub as a used one isn't but about $25-40 typically.
Upgrade to chromoly manual hub studs.
